1. The Rolex GMT-Master II: Evolution, Not Revolution:
The Basel World Rolex GMT updates were arguably the most anticipated. The GMT-Master II, a cornerstone of Rolex's sports watch collection and a favourite among travellers and aviation enthusiasts, received a significant refresh. While not a complete overhaul, the changes were impactful. The most striking alteration was the introduction of new dial and bezel combinations. These weren't simply minor color variations; they represented a thoughtful evolution of the GMT-Master II's design language. The introduction of new ceramic bezel inserts in vibrant colors, alongside updated dial textures and indices, breathed new life into this iconic timepiece. The subtle shifts in color palettes, often referencing past models, demonstrated Rolex's understanding of its heritage while simultaneously pushing the design forward. The new colorways, including the highly sought-after Pepsi bezel and the more subdued 'Root Beer' combination, became instant collector's items. These weren't just cosmetic changes; they demonstrated Rolex's keen eye for detail and its ability to reinterpret classic designs for a contemporary audience. The improved legibility of the dials, often cited as a minor weakness in previous iterations, also received positive feedback.
